随着互联网技术的发展,越来越多的企业将业务搬到了线上。但与此网络攻击事件也层出不穷,其中DDoS(分布式拒绝服务)攻击是较为常见的一种。DDoS攻击通常通过向目标系统发送大量的请求来耗尽其资源或带宽,使合法用户无法正常访问该系统。本文将介绍企业如何检测并确认其网站服务器是否正在遭遇发包攻击。
一、流量异常波动
当企业的网站服务器遭受发包攻击时,最直接的表现就是网络流量突然增大。如果在没有重大营销活动或者特殊节假日的情况下,发现短期内大量IP地址频繁访问网站,并且这些访问行为呈现出无规律可循的特点,那么很可能是受到了攻击。还可以观察到网站响应时间变长,页面加载缓慢甚至出现超时错误。
二、CPU和内存使用率飙升
除了网络流量的变化外,服务器本身的性能指标也会受到影响。正常情况下,一台健康的服务器应该保持较低水平的CPU和内存占用率;而在受到攻击期间,由于要处理过多的并发连接请求,会导致这两个关键参数急剧上升。定期监控服务器状态对于及时发现潜在威胁至关重要。
三、日志文件分析
通过查看Web服务器的日志文件也可以帮助我们判断是否存在发包攻击的风险。例如,在Apache或Nginx等主流Web服务器软件中,可以找到记录了每一次HTTP请求信息的日志文档。对于疑似被攻击的情况,我们应该重点关注以下几个方面:
– 来源IP分布:统计每个IP发起请求数量,找出那些明显高于平均水平的可疑对象;
– URL路径特征:检查是否有特定资源被恶意利用,如登录接口、搜索框等;
– 用户代理字符串:部分自动化工具会携带特殊的标识符,便于识别;
– 时间戳间隔:分析请求之间的时间差,确定是否存在周期性脉冲现象。
四、借助第三方安全平台
除了依靠自身的技术力量之外,许多专业的网络安全公司还提供了专门针对DDoS防护的服务。它们拥有强大的数据分析能力和丰富的应对经验,能够更加快速准确地定位问题所在。一旦检测到异常情况,就会立即采取措施进行拦截和过滤,从而保障客户的业务连续性和数据安全性。
五、总结
企业要想有效防范发包攻击,就必须从多个角度出发,综合运用各种手段来进行监测和预警。同时也要不断优化自身的防御体系,提高抗风险能力。只有这样,才能在日益复杂的网络环境中立于不败之地。
文章推荐更多>
- 1电脑如何下载谷歌浏览器 电脑端获取谷歌浏览器指南
- 2mysql如何实现读已提交
- 3redis的五种数据类型命令有哪些
- 4mysql数据库环境变量怎么配
- 5wordpress网站是什么
- 6Win10系统如何使用手写输入法?Win10系统使用手写输入法的方法
- 7wordpress如何实现跳转外部链接
- 8mongodb能存什么
- 9redis的五种数据类型及使用场景有哪些
- 10phpmyadmin服务器没有响应该怎么办
- 11uc浏览器可以解压7z吗 uc支持7z格式解压操作教程
- 12phpmyadmin怎么改表名
- 13oracle删除数据如何恢复
- 14mysql怎么恢复修改的数据
- 15wordpress如何禁用谷歌地图
- 16wordpress怎么更新
- 17mysql sid是什么意思
- 180x000000ed蓝屏代码是什么意思 蓝屏代码0x000000ed的应对措施
- 19mysql数据库使用什么语言
- 20mysql数据库可视化软件有哪些
- 21SSL/TLS配置:OpenSSL生成证书与测试
- 22wordpress是怎么添加登录的
- 23mysql属于什么类型的数据库?
- 24wordpress网站怎么提供下载文件
- 25UC缓存视频转存到新设备
- 26怎么登陆wordpress后台
- 27dedecms系统怎么用
- 28yandex引擎入口登录无需密码https yandex无需登录入口引擎官网
- 29mysql如何设置环境变量
- 30 如何用手机制作网站和网页,手机移动端的网站能制作成中英双语的吗?
